Cinderella's Frozen Castle

+ Posted by Josh Hallett on 01.04.08 // 03:04 PM

During the holidays Cinderella's castle at Walt Disney World is covered with icicle lights. It's a sight to see, while it lasts. A few days before they're scheduled to be taken down I ventured out in the Florida cold (40's) to get some night shots with the new tripod. The full set is here. I also plan to post some fireworks shots as well.

Cinderella's Castle with Icicles - Walt Disney World

The photo above the the 'standard' light for the castle, but as the castle lighting changes to different hues, it changes the look of the icicles.

Cinderella's Castle with Icicles - Walt Disney World

Cinderella's Castle with Icicles - Walt Disney World

One of my favorite castle shots is always from the side with the reflection in the moat.
